Arizona education department seeks public feedback on science, social studies standards
By Yoohyun Jung • Arizona Daily Star
The state education department wants the public’s feedback on existing science and social studies standards.
The science standards were adopted in 2004 and social studies, 2005. The department launched a public survey to seek input. It will be open until Dec. 3.
Educators can apply to serve on the revision committees for each of the content areas.
